Output 18e117d7868bfed9343d9dd204e2214ddc006b98f9fa80e96fa2b68bfa993089:161

value
74877
script pubkey
OP_0 OP_PUSHBYTES_20 aa92b1953901f0ed0c9159d880a58d83adae26a2
address
bc1q42ftr9feq8cw6ry3t8vgpfvdswk6uf4zqnymyy
transaction
18e117d7868bfed9343d9dd204e2214ddc006b98f9fa80e96fa2b68bfa993089
confirmations
49454
spent
true